    Just recently i had problems with my 1997 grand prix going into what i believe is limp mode. A friend told me that its probably my speed sensor and im trying to figure out where they are located. Also i was wondering if the abs/tire pressure/ trac control sensor located on the front wheels act as a speed sensor also??

    The vehicle speed sensor (VSS) is located on the differential cover. Passenger side of the car, right where the passenger side axle connects to the transmission.

    The ABS sensors are only used for the ABS and traction control systems. They don't measure the vehicle's speed. Instead they monitor individual wheel speeds so the system can compare them to each other.

What are the symptoms of a failing speed sensor?

Improper Or Harsh Shifting When there's no speed signal coming from the sensors, shifting of gears will be a problem because the powertrain control module won't control them correctly. This will make the transmission not work properly. It will either shift more quickly or roughly than expected.

Does the transmission speed sensor control the speedometer?

The speed sensor is a small device that tells your car's speedometer how fast you're going. It plays a role in your car's transmission and cruise control systems.
